What is cryptocurrency? Cryptocurrency for beginners

The idea of what cryptocurrency or digital currency is can still pose some unclear thoughts in the mind of many people. Cryptocurrency, to put it simply, is a form of digital currency. It is a derived name for bitcoin and other currency of its kind.

However, this form of currency is a unique one because the system is decentralized. That is to say, it is not centrally controlled either by a single body or even the central bank, making it impossible to fake transactions. The currency is regulated by some complex mathematical encryption techniques through a process known as mining or digging and uses a currency called Bitcoin.

What is Bitcoin?

Bitcoin is a special type of cryptocurrency being the first of its kind. Although it has been around for a while, it was created in 2009 by Satoshi Nakamoto. Bitcoin transactions are made with no middlemen of any type or form, and unlike the regular paper money, bitcoins can only be stored in a digital wallet. However, it can also be used for any type of transaction across the globe just like the regular currency.

To be more pragmatic, bitcoin is just simply another kind of money. Although it cannot be physically handled, it can be electronically controlled. Think of bitcoin as virtual money you can use to buy goods and services or even trade in the financial market.

How does the bitcoin cryptocurrency work?

In a technical sense, Bitcoins are blocks of sophisticated and highly secured mathematical algorithms and data that are treated as money. The exchange of these data and the verification of the transactions involved from one person to another requires a lot of computing powers. The cryptocurrency system in general centers on an incredibly complex cryptography known as the blockchain. There are cryptographic sequences that are involved in generating new bitcoins and verification of transactions between users of bitcoin.

Controllers of the currency possess equipment that can be used to perform these complex mathematical calculations and procedures for the various transactions going on in the system and in return, new blocks of bitcoins are generated.

These newly generated blocks of bitcoins are then shared accordingly among the people who contributed to the process. This process is what is known as “bitcoin mining”. The amount of bitcoin block an individual gets depends mostly on the amount of hash power contributed to the mining process.

It is important to also note that bitcoins have to be mined before they can be spent just like the conventional currency has to be minted by a government.

Advantages and disadvantages of cryptocurrency

Cryptocurrency comes with many advantages as well as disadvantages. The fact that bitcoin is decentralized (no country’s government owns it) gives it an edge over the conventional currency. So think of it as a payment system where a large amount of money can be moved from one user or place to another without any hassle either from the bank or the government.

With bitcoin, one of the main advantages is that there is no limit to the number of transactions or money that can be transferred from one end to another at any point in time. More also, bitcoin transactions are done anonymously. Unless the person who performs a transaction identifies himself or herself, no one can know who did the operation or from what end a transaction has been done.

One major glitch that bitcoin has is the price fluctuation. The demand and supply chain determine the price at any point in time. In the early days, bitcoin was worth only a few cents, but now its value is about $5,940. Aside from that, bitcoin and cryptocurrency at large has proven to be one of the best mediums of exchange and could be the future of money. This is because;

  1. ransactions done with bitcoin are almost impossible to counterfeit.
  2. Transactions with bitcoins can be made anonymously.
  3. Transactions made with bitcoin are processed within minutes irrespective of the size.
  4. The value of bitcoin is only determined by the supply and demand chain and cannot be influenced by any government.
  5. A bitcoin account can be created in no time without having to go through any stress or a lot of unending verification process.
  6. Transaction fees are comparatively low.

How to get started with cryptocurrency

First of all, it is essential to know that bitcoin is money in every economic sense. Hence, you can either earn it (request to be paid in bitcoin for goods and services) or buy it from one of the numerous exchangers online with a conventional currency. Another right way to have bitcoin is to buy from someone who already has and is willing to sell it. However, the first step to having bitcoin is creating a bitcoin wallet.

The bitcoin wallet works similarly as your bank account. It is just that in this case, you are your own cashier and account manager. Based on recent development, bitcoin can now be spent easily, anywhere across the globe using the bitcoin ATM card. The bitcoin ATM card can be used similarly as the regular credit and debit cards.

There is a corresponding value of the fiat currency that is attached to the bitcoin in your wallet. This allows for a smooth transaction and simplicity as the price tags on most goods and services are not displayed in bitcoin.
